Shai Gilgeous-Alexander vs Nikola Jokic was the highlight of Sunday afternoon, and surprisingly, it did disappoint. The 127-103 win showed again just how far this OKC Thunder team has elevated themselves. SGA was again the difference maker, with his 40 points compared to Jokic’s 24. That wasn’t all. The Canadian also managed to unlock a shiny new achievement. But the way Shai did, it was not in a crowd-pleasing manner.
With the latest 30+ game, SGA made himself part of an exclusive list. He became the second player in the last 40 years to record 30+ points in 40+ games over 3 consecutive seasons. The other one? The legendary Michael Jeffrey Jordan. That’s some elite accomplishment. But instead of celebrating this remarkable achievement, the NBA community couldn’t stop talking about his on-court antics that led to those points.

A clip is going viral on X where Shai is seen attempting a layup when Nuggets’ Russell Westbrook has a slight collision with him. Shai fell to the floor. The ball missed the target and Russ was handed a foul. The unforgiving fans roared in the comment section, with one of them saying, “You can’t be a hoops fan and think Shai game is pure. It’s nasty.”
